Data is a 4 Letter Word

In most organizations there is a clear and frustrating disconnect between the executives who want data and the analysts who create and work with it, sometimes data can seem like a four-letter word. Is there a solution?

In this on-demand webinar, Napkyn Founder, Jim Cain, discusses a framework he developed over a ten-year period working with senior executives across North America to address the frustration that plagues organizations and executives that want to lead with data. It is a tool being used to translate the elusive promise and potential of ‘data-driven’, into progress and results.
